German

[edit]

Etymology

[edit]

From late Middle High German bündel, diminutive of bunt; equivalent to Bund +‎ -el.

Pronunciation

[edit]
  • IPA(key): /ˈbʏndəl/, [ˈbʏndl̩]
  • Audio:(file)

Noun

[edit]

Bündel n (strong, genitive Bündels, plural Bündel, diminutive Bündelchen n)

  1. bundle
    Er nahm sein Bündel und zog davon.
    He took his bundle and walked away.
